RECOMMENDATION

Recommendation

Staff recommends that the City Council approve, by motion, the reappointment of Cultural Arts Commissioners Maharaj, Huerta, and Ramos to their respective four-year terms expiring July 10, 2030.

 

Body

BACKGROUND/DISCUSSION

As indicated in the newly adopted City Council Handbook, a total of three incumbents received written communication informing them of their upcoming term expirations. All three members have confirmed their continued interest in serving on the Cultural Arts Commission. 

Below are the recommended reappointments: 

The Cultural Arts Commission meets on the fourth Tuesday of every month at 6:30 p.m. in the Library Parks and Recreation Center located at 901 Civic Campus Way. Commissioners are appointed to four (4) year terms and are limited to three (3) consecutive terms. The Commission encourages and promotes cultural arts activities within the community and acts as an advisory body to the City Council on matters pertaining to the arts and cultural affairs.

Cultural Arts Commission

Zubin Maharaj - eligible for reappointment

Commissioner Maharaj was appointed on  April 2, 2021, to a term ending June 13, 2026.

Alexia Huerta - eligible for reappointment

Commissioner Huerta was appointed on  August 30, 2023, to a term ending June 13, 2026.

Vivian Ramos - eligible for reappointment

Commissioner Ramos was appointed on  February 21, 2024, to a term ending June 13, 2026.

 

FISCAL IMPACT

There is no fiscal impact associated with this action.
